Housing Assistance Usage Rules

Summary

Housing assistance in Massachusetts, such as Section 8, requires recipients to report household changes to the housing authority. Assistance use in shared living arrangements must be verified with the housing authority or landlord. Unauthorized occupants can lead to lease violations. Rent calculations may be adjusted based on household income. Consult the housing authority for specific program rules.
